With the advancements in technology, the exchange of knowledge base and the intellectual economy is growing at a rapid pace. Likewise, the concern for protecting intellectual property rights. The importance of intellectual property and its mobility is well-established and reflected across all industries. Can a person get an IP for a tribal song? What are the controversies around R&D incentives, pricing and access to medicines and intellectual property in the pharma industries? What are the implications of IPR on the next-gen AI technology that comes with unpredictable intelligence and capabilities of machine learning? These are some intriguing questions and debates that will be addressed by industry leaders through our webinar series.
This module deals with sector-specific intellectual property rights that cover various topics related to the pharmaceutical industry, entertainment, media and sports, data protection and software etc.
At the end of this module, you will be able to develop a legal acumen on industry practices in IPR and discuss various facets of IP with industry experts and law professionals.

Ashok G.V.
Partner, Factum Law
Ashok G.V. is a dispute resolution counsel with expertise in Intellectual Property Rights, representing clients across diverse sectors including healthcare, technology, and real estate. He has extensive experience in IP litigation, securing several John Doe orders, and advising on global IP protection and enforcement. Ashok is a regular speaker at top institutions, including NLSIU, IIT Kharagpur, and IIM Bangalore.

Rajesh Ramanathan
Partner, Factum Law
Rajesh Ramanathan, with over 24 years in commercial dispute resolution, specializes in IP litigation, prosecution, and anti-counterfeiting. Formerly head of IP at a national firm, he is an alumnus of Franklin Pierce Law Center.

Rohan Rohatgi
Founding Partner, RSR Legal
Rohan has over 15 years of experience specialising in IP, media, sports, technology, and data protection laws. He handles IP litigation, arbitrations, and regulatory issues for e-commerce. Rohan is an active speaker, educating on IP laws and has delivered numerous webinars on AI, cultural expressions, and trademarks.

Tarun Khurana
Partner & IP Attorney, IIPRD & Khurana & Khurana
Tarun has 20+ years of experience in Intellectual Property (IP) and is the Co-founding Partner and Patent Attorney of Khurana & Khurana (K&K) and IIPRD. These firms are leaders in IP and corporate law, with 10 offices in India and regional offices globally. Tarun is ranked among India's top 12 patent prosecution practitioners by IAM 1000 and IAM 300 strategists. He specialises in patent preparation/drafting, portfolio management, IP/commercial litigation, valuation, and IP commercialisation for a wide range of clients, from startups to Fortune 500 companies. His expertise covers electronics, telecom, computer-implemented, and mechanical subjects, and he provides patent support services to US and European firms and corporates. Tarun holds degrees in computer science engineering, software systems, law, and an MBA. He is a regular speaker at various institutes and conferences, including GIPC, WIPF, CII, FICCI, and more.
